Output 84f96b14654111c9431793afda06c5e945712132b3b56a1a82da6b7ce84b6da4:171

value
103913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ce42dcc1d4426189edc84deabf3c10ef73b48512 OP_EQUAL
address
MShmXd7wAehjbNa4S27VsXxpdQn5kLdgqj
transaction
84f96b14654111c9431793afda06c5e945712132b3b56a1a82da6b7ce84b6da4
spent
true